How will you fit in the big picture?

As an Operations Planner Generalist, you will independently execute planning activities across supply and operations planning. You will turn demand and operational requirements into accurate, executable production and materials plans, influence outcomes through thoughtful analysis, and help the team achieve service, inventory, and financial objectives in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.

What will you do?

  • Develop and communicate detailed production schedules for assigned operations in support of the master production schedule and longer-term planning strategy.
  • Manage MRP parameters and material requirements to support timely purchasing and delivery while meeting inventory objectives.
  • Analyze inventory performance, material availability, capacity, and shared resources; recommend actions that improve flow, service, cost, and productivity.
  • Maintain accurate bills of material and routing information and support effective execution of engineering changes.
  • Own defined planning processes and small projects, track progress, resolve non-routine issues, and deliver commitments on time.
  • Partner with Operations, Procurement, Logistics, suppliers, and other stakeholders to communicate constraints, risks, dependencies, and recommended solutions.

Minimum Requirements

  • Experience: 3+ years of relevant experience in supply chain and/or manufacturing, with experience in production planning, scheduling, inventory, or materials management. Experience using SAP or a similar ERP system and Microsoft Office, particularly Excel, is required; JDA experience is a plus.
  • Education: Bachelor's degree preferred, ideally with emphasis in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, or a related field.
  • Skills and knowledge: Supply chain management, inventory management, planning, materials management, operations management, structured problem-solving, analysis, clear written and verbal communication, teamwork, and the ability to prioritize multiple activities in changing conditions.
